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36 347013 5796 25787 833369
769 0776 3710891
769 0776 3710891
915 2037354699 669696
All about undefined
Interested in learning more?
769 0776 3710891
915 2037354699 669696
See more
8681012881 36228327 772
55629529 03770341 821
See more
265509 53644963260 042
241077 349275959 37 562025 332183441
See more